To find out what the problem is, click select the miner and click the Diagnostics button in the toolbar. This will open a window that specifies the exact command line arguments Awesome Miner uses to launch the mining software together with additional information from the mining software that could indicate what the problem is. Please review this information to find a solution.

Hello Patrike,
Sometimes the windows process crash at the begin of the mining, and windows debugging is asking to close/force stop the window.

Can you add a watch dog on the awesome miner client , if the miner didn't start or speed is equal with 0 , to identify the Process PID and close it? Like that the Awsome miner server will be able to proper start the mining window again, otherwise it get stuck, Server side see it as a running process, but client is not running at all.
Thanks,

Hi,
Although I've already answered this one via PM. I'm also providing the answer here because it may be useful for others as well.

The solution is to configure Windows to not show those crash dialogs. They are preventing the process from exiting and it will still be considered running by both Windows and Awesome Miner.
Please see this link for instructions: https://superuser.com/a/715645
After that modification, Awesome Miner should detect it as a crash and simply restart the mining process.

As you know Nicehash is down today. When using profit switching on a antminer what happens when a pool is dead? If the most profitable pool is dead, does it use the second most profitable?
If you have more than one pool on your Antminer, your Antminer will automatically failover to the next pool in the list according to priority - so it's fully compatible with the profit switching feature in Awesome Miner.
